OHIO — The Northern Ohio Violent Fugitive Task Force (NOVFTF) is asking for the public’s help in locating Kenneth Kirk, 44, who is wanted by the U.S. Marshals Service in Toledo for violating his supervised release.
Kirk was previously convicted in U.S. District Court of being a felon in possession of a firearm.
He was sentenced to 30 months in federal prison, followed by three years of supervised release.
In November 2024, a warrant was issued for his arrest after he absconded from supervision.
Authorities say Kirk is known to frequent Toledo’s southside and eastside. His last known location was in the 2100 block of Broadway.
He is described as a white male, 6 feet 2 inches tall, weighing 300 pounds, with brown hair and hazel eyes.
Officials warn that he should be considered armed and dangerous.
